The KPM has a broad national and international network and cooperates with numerous universities and research centers as well as with partners from public administration, politics and practice. These collaborations form the basis for joint research projects, academic exchange and the development of innovative solutions to current challenges in public management.
Within the University of Bern, the KPM is involved in various inter- and transdisciplinary initiatives, including with the Multidisciplinary Center for Infectious Diseases (MCID), the Oeschger Centre for Climate Change Research (OCCR), the Institute of Information Systems (IWI) and, through the Chair of Regulatory Affairs, with sitem-insel. There are also close collaborations with further institutes and faculties of the University of Bern.
At the national level, the KPM works regularly with partners such as the Bern University of Applied Sciences (BFH), the Centre for Legislative Studies (ZfR) and the Centre for Democracy Studies Aarau (ZDA). These collaborations make it possible to address complex questions at the interface of public administration, politics, law, digitalization and society.
Internationally, the KPM maintains research collaborations and partnerships with universities and research institutions abroad. The exchange of researchers and joint projects foster new perspectives and methods and strengthen the international visibility and reputation of the KPM.
The KPM's network is also reflected in its active involvement in academic networks, expert bodies and research evaluations, as well as in continuous exchange with public administrations at the federal, cantonal and communal level.
